Not only does it dry laundry, but the ventilation function also expels moisture after each bath, preventing mold. / We are committed to building wooden homes, believing that wood, which constantly breathes and expands and contracts subtly with changes in the weather, is ideal for Japan's hot and humid climate. This construction method, which uses wooden cores to build the framework of a home—including the foundation, pillars, and beams—has been refined and developed over more than 1,000 years. / A slab foundation covers the entire ground, distributing the building's weight to the ground and improving durability against uneven settlement and earthquake resistance. / We select the appropriate earthquake-resistant metal fittings for each joint—the foundation, base, and pillars—to securely fasten the structure. By focusing on parts that are not visible from the outside, we prevent the building from warping or collapsing during earthquakes and increase the durability of the entire home. / This construction method directly fastens structural surface materials to the foundation and beams, integrating the entire house into a single floor, resulting in a structure that is extremely resistant to lateral forces. This prevents twisting of the house and provides excellent earthquake resistance. / Ventilation is 1.5 to 2 times more effective than conventional methods.
